The Fed voted unanimously to hold rates steady on Wednesday, but markets sure didn’t trade like it was a quiet decision! The dollar jumped nearly 1%, gold dropped more than 2%, and stocks closed sharply lower as traders looked past the headline and focused on what the Fed was really signaling. So if you read “Fed holds rates” and then checked your charts with a confused little squint, you weren’t wrong. The headline sounded calm, but the details underneath told a very different story.
